India has announced a policy shift mandating the sale of only made-in-India CCTV units starting April 1. This decision comes after the government barred the sale of non-certified imported CCTV units from April 2025. This move is set to encourage domestic production and compliance with the Standardisation Testing and Quality Certification (STQC) regime.The Ministry of Electronics and IT's directive has significantly impacted foreign manufacturers, particularly Chinese companies like Hikvision and TP-Link, whose products are yet to receive STQC certification.
